Update on reader help, 1996 Saab 900SE - 45K miles
1. exhaust - installed Saab Sport exhaust - very pleased with purchase,
not too loud, does appear to free up some horsepower
2. cabin air filter - was filthy, first time installation took about an
hour, need to be very careful not to mess up paint taking out parts and
pieces
3. New questions- any suggestions on best place to have my CD changer
looked at. Unit has been skipping over hard bumps, ruined one CD. Dealer
can handle but could I simply send to mfr.? Any help would be appreciated.
4. Headline - drooping a bit at front edges at windshield just above sun
visors - thought Saab could have fixed this after all these years?

Also, got to drive a 9-5 wagon, auto loaner car w/ 185 hp. very
impressive ... much more pep than I would have guessed...
